Output b54def5f369183a9dee6d66fc7d0d1503fd7e81a0b5290edf801de15a8a510c6:4

value
2544859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ddc903f4e2663c815980c3e6600053878e65a01 OP_EQUAL
address
35sWZCEE5ge5m2HaFxcipuCiCwJAQB97W7
transaction
b54def5f369183a9dee6d66fc7d0d1503fd7e81a0b5290edf801de15a8a510c6
confirmations
336118
spent
true